Bio

     As a general family practitioner, Alisha helps people with a variety of conditions and enjoys seeing patients of all ages. Natural pain management, neurological conditions, feelings of anxiety, and digestive disorders are some of the top reasons patients seek Alisha's help. Her further training in pediatrics and non-needle techniques is why Eugene Family Acupuncture is known as Eugene's pediatric friendly acupuncture clinic.

 

     Many of her patients are looking for safe, effective treatment, to avoid invasive, side effect ridden options. Some have already reached a dead end after trying other medical interventions, turning to acupuncture as their last resort. Other patients are currently on treatment plans with other medical providers, looking for an integrative medicine approach. For these patients, Alisha appropriately integrates acupuncture & Chinese medicine into existing treatment plans to maximize results for the patient.
